Sprinkle pork chops with sage, salt & pepper. Cover with apple juice. … WebJun 29, 2024 · Roast the pork, uncovered, until the internal temperature reaches 190 to 195°F (88 to 91°C). By this point the exterior should be crispy and dry—this is similar to what’s referred to as “bark” when smoking on a grill. This can take anywhere from 4 to 10 hours, depending on your oven and the size of your pork butt.
